sort排序 和 uniq排重

sort:对文件中的各行进行排序

改变缺省设置的选项主要有:
  - m 合并文件,按照文件内容自身顺序。
  - c 检查给定文件是否已排好序,如果它们没有都排好序,则打印一个出错信息,并以状态值1退出。
  - u 对排序后认为相同的行只留其中一行。
  - o 输出文件 将排序输出写到输出文件中而不是标准输出,如果输出文件是输入文件之一,sort先将该文件的内容写入一个临时文件,然后再排序和写输出结果。

改变缺省排序规则的选项主要有:
  - d 按字典顺序排序,比较时仅字母、数字、空格和制表符有意义。
  - f 将小写字母与大写字母同等对待。
  - I 忽略非打印字符。
  - M 作为月份比较:“JAN”<“FEB” p>
  - r 按逆序输出排序结果。

uniq:过滤、统计、删除重复行

该命令各选项含义如下:
  - c 显示输出中,在每行行首加上本行在文件中出现的次数。它可取代- u和- d选项。
  - d 只显示重复行。
  - u 只显示文件中不重复的各行。
  - n 前n个字段与每个字段前的空白一起被忽略。一个字段是一个非空格、非制表符的字符串,彼此由制表符和空格隔开(字段从0开始编号)。

你可能感兴趣的:(sort排序 和 uniq排重)